“…The correspondence between the chemical structure information and the DNA barcode sequence is essential to library selection and hit decoding (Figure ). Therefore, preserving the information stored within the DNA barcodes during DEL construction is an essential requirement of DNA-compatible chemistry . Chemical transformations in DEL synthesis need robustness, and reactions that cause DNA damage must be avoided. , If the integrity of the DNA tag is compromised, it can undermine coding fidelity and lead to false hit identification in the decoding process by next-generation sequencing (NGS) …”

“…Thus, chemical diversity is one of the most critical characterizations for a library distinguishing itself from others . So far, library construction heavily relies on several widely validated water-compatible reactions like amide formation, nucleophilic substitution, reductive amination and Suzuki coupling . In spite of the abundance of building blocks, the limitation of reaction types could be the Achilles’ Heel for the development of this technology.…”
